With reference to colonial period of Indian history, Match List-I with List-II and select the correct answer: List-I (Person) List-II (Event) A. Macdonald

  1. Doctrine of Lapse B. Linlithgow
  2. Communal Award C. Dalhousie
  3. August Offer D. Chelmsford
  4. Dyarchy Codes: A B C D
  1. A 3 2 1 4
  2. B 3 2 4 1
  3. C 2 3 1 4 ✓
  4. D 2 3 4 1
✓ Correct answer: (C)

Assertion (A)Lord Linlithgow described the August Movement of 1942 as the most serious revolt after the Sepoy mutiny
Reason (R)Peasants joined the movement in large number in some places
  1. A Both A and Rare true but R is the correct explanation of A ✓
  2. B Both A and R are true but R is not a correct explanation of A
  3. C A is true but R is false
  4. D A is false but R is
✓ Correct answer: (A)
